What is PVC Pipe?
PVC pipes, short for polyvinyl chloride pipes, are widely recognized for their versatility. These pipes are highly durable, capable of withstanding heavy use in areas like plumbing, construction, and irrigation. Their corrosion and chemical resistance make them ideal for transporting water, chemicals, and gases.
Lightweight and easy to handle, they simplify installations. Despite being tough, PVC pipes remain flexible enough for various setups. They are fire-resistant, UV-resistant (in some cases), and affordable compared to other piping materials.

Types of PVC Pipes Available
PVC pipes fall into different categories based on their strength, wall thickness, and intended use. The most common varieties include:
- Schedule 40 for general plumbing and water flow.
- Schedule 80 for high-pressure systems.
- Flexible PVC pipes, designed for irrigation or pool systems.
- Clear PVC pipes, suitable for visibility of flow in laboratory or aquarium setups.
Each type of PVC pipe comes with varying pressure ratings and applications, catering to a broad range of industries and purposes.

PVC Pipe Fittings and Connectors
Elbows
Elbow connectors create smooth directional changes in the pipeline. They are available in various degrees, often 90° or 45°, to ensure seamless flow without interruption.
Tees
PVC tees help create branch points in the plumbing system. They allow users to redirect water or gases into two separate pathways effectively.
Couplings
Couplings connect two lengths of pipe. They are essential for projects where extending existing lines is necessary.
Adapters
Adapters help convert pipe diameters or transition from one connection style to another. Their versatility ensures compatibility in complex configurations.

How to Choose the Right PVC Pipe
Understanding Pipe Sizes
Home Depot categorizes pipes by nominal inside diameter and outside diameter, ensuring customers find an accurate fit.
Considering Pipe Schedules
Pipe schedules refer to wall thickness. While Schedule 40 suffices for regular plumbing, Schedule 80 is preferred for high-pressure applications.
Evaluating Pipe Lengths
PVC pipes at Home Depot are available in lengths ranging from 2 feet to 20 feet. Always select a length appropriate for your specific project’s needs to avoid unnecessary cuts.
